Responsibilities
  • Responsible for performance of direct & indirect reports (Workstream Leads, internal PMO and external PMO).
  • Implementing the program structure including workstreams, communication, documentation, reporting, controls and progress tracking, as well as monitoring adherence and taking appropriate measures in case of deviations.
  • Defining, implementing and utilizing program control processes, procedures and related tools, as well as ensuring relevant people are trained.
  • Defining and implementing the program governance structure, taking the lead in reporting out to Nutreco global management and BU management.
  • Development, implementation, utilization and tracking of a program integrated activity schedule to ensure meeting agreed program milestones.
  • Managing the program’s budget (CAPEX and OPEX) – controlling commitments, spending and forecasts against baseline budgets, as well as providing cost analyses as needed.
  • Investing more than 170 Mio € according to the plan already presented to Nutreco MB, adjusting timing and budgets accordingly in time.
  • Managing overall program risks and issues and leading the definition of corrective actions, as well as monitoring actions progress.
  • Managing program changes (changes to scope, organization, etc) according to a change management process.
  • Working closely with the BU HR function, managing the required changes in the BU organisation as the program is delivered.
  • Implementing an efficient communications structure between Workstream Leads, PMO, BU stakeholders and stakeholders outside of the BU.
  • Acting as an inspiration and motivator to direct reports and program stakeholders.

What you bring
  • 15 years experience with managing business transformation programs in manufacturing industry, preferably animal / aquafeed, food, FMCG or fine chemicals.
  • 5 years experience with PMO / program management roles, managing the scope, budget and schedule of a complex program.
  • 5 years experience with managing teams of subject matter experts in an international environment.
  • Minimum Bachelor level education.
  • Fluent in English and Spanish (verbal and writing).
  • Excellent communication skills (verbal and writing), both to local (project) teams and to senior management levels.
  • Practical, hands-on, active attitude and interest to engage pro-actively with project teams.
  • Demonstrated experience in an Operations management related role (e.g. production, supply chain, etc.).
  • Having lived and worked outside of home location for at least 2 years.
